Tell me the significance of the Carole King and James Taylor story.

1 answer
2024-11-26 20:48

The Carole King and James Taylor story is important because they both emerged during a time when the music industry was evolving. Their music was relatable and touched on themes like love, loss, and self - discovery. For example, Carole King's 'Tapestry' and James Taylor's 'Sweet Baby James' are iconic albums that showcase their talent. They also often performed together, which brought their individual fan bases together and increased their overall influence in the music scene.

Can you tell me the significance of Carole King's 'Tapestry' story?

2 answers
2024-12-01 19:50

The 'Tapestry' story is highly significant. It was a milestone in Carole King's career. The album 'Tapestry' was a huge success, showcasing her songwriting prowess. It contained many of her classic songs that were both personal and relatable. It also had a major impact on the music industry at the time, influencing other female singer - songwriters.

Tell me the Carole King story.

2 answers
2024-10-25 00:48

Carole King is a highly influential American singer - songwriter. Her story is one of great musical achievement. She started her career in the early days of rock and roll, writing many hit songs for other artists. Her album 'Tapestry' was a huge success, becoming one of the best - selling albums of all time. It was not only a commercial success but also a critical one, with its blend of personal lyrics and beautiful melodies. King's music has influenced generations of musicians, and her story is a testament to the power of songwriting and the ability to connect with audiences on a deep emotional level.
